ReactOS on EEEPC
Well, it will not only be possible to install ROS from USB, but also it will be possible to install ROS on a USB drive. This will enable us to boot and run ROS from an external drive like an extra OS not affecting any setting on the primary drive much like a live cd works but without the downsides of not being able to change any settings or save the work easily.
First however we must have a working USB stack and drivers to be able to do so, Fireball has made a lot of what is needed, but it isn't ready, so if someone needs a challenge to prove thay you are manly, you are welcome to take a bite out of it.
